What to Look For Before Buying
When selecting the right insulation, it is essential to understand your specific noise or heat challenge. Consider the density of the material, as higher density generally correlates with better sound blocking.
Check Assess Your Noise Source
Identify whether you need to block external noise or reduce internal echoes. For internal reverberation, acoustic foam wedges are highly effective. For blocking external sound, high-density mass-loaded materials perform better.
Value Material Density Matters
Density is a primary indicator of how well a material will block sound. Look for foam or mats with a high kg/m³ rating. Heavier materials absorb more sound energy and provide better vibration dampening.
Rating Prioritize Fire Safety
Always check for fire-resistant ratings like B1 or similar industry certifications. Fire-retardant materials are non-negotiable for home and studio safety. These materials self-extinguish when exposed to flames, preventing the spread of fire. Never compromise safety for a lower price point.
Verify Installation Ease
Consider whether the product includes integrated adhesive or requires separate glue. Self-adhesive panels save time and reduce mess during installation. If you prefer a permanent, clean finish, opt for products with full-surface backing. Test a small area first to ensure proper adhesion to your wall surface.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use acoustic foam for thermal insulation?
Yes, many high-density acoustic foams provide secondary thermal benefits. They help maintain room temperature by acting as a barrier against heat transfer.
How do I install these without damaging my walls?
Using command strips or temporary mounting adhesive can help prevent wall damage. If the product has a strong permanent adhesive, consider applying it to a thin board first. You can then mount that board to the wall.
Why is my foam taking so long to expand?
Vacuum packing compresses the foam significantly. It can take up to 48 hours to regain its original shape naturally.
Are these materials safe for home studios?
Yes, most modern acoustic foams are non-toxic and fire-retardant. Always look for products that specify no chemical odors. Proper ventilation during initial installation is also recommended.
Do I need to cover every square inch of the wall?
Not necessarily. For echo reduction, covering 20% to 40% of the surface area is often enough.
